What's The Definition Of Paragogic?Synonyms | Synonyms for Paragogic: Related Terms | Find terms related to Paragogic: See Also | Paragogic In Webster's Dictionary \Par`a*gog"ic\, Paragogical \Par`a*gog"ic*al\, a. [Cf.
F. paragogique.]
Of, pertaining to, or constituting, a paragoge; added to the
end of, or serving to lengthen, a word.
{Paragogic letters}, in the Semitic languages, letters which
are added to the ordinary forms of words, to express
additional emphasis, or some change in the sense.
